The majority race in Fort Bend County overall is white, making up 32.4% of residents. The next most-common racial group is hispanic at 23.5%. There are more white people in the northwest areas of the county. People who identify as hispanic are most likely to be living in the southwest places. Diversity and Diversity Scores for Fort Bend County, TX
The map below shows diversity in Fort Bend County. Areas in green are more diverse, while areas in red are much less diverse. Diversity, in this case, means a mixture of people with different race and ethnicity living close to one another. For example, all-black and all-white areas in the county would both be considered lacking diversity.
Diversity Score
Fort Bend County Diversity Score
99
With a diversity score of 99 out of 100, Fort Bend County is much more diverse than other US counties. The most diverse area within Fort Bend County's proper boundaries is to the south of the county. The least diverse areas are located in the southwest parts of Fort Bend County.
